On Sept 8th 1966 from 8:30 to 9:30 pm a new tv show is aired.
https://en.m.wikipedia.org/wiki/The_Man_Trap
After a few fits and starts, a discarded pilot and almost being cancelled before it began by Desilu studios because of its costs "The Man Trap" debuts.
Something different, it won its time slot and was just the beginning of a 50 year run in tv, conventions, movies and more...and still continues today.
Not one the best episodes, that salt vampire was kind of hokey, but everything has to start somewhere.
I watched it that night, talked my mom into letting me stay up late to watch it and I was 11 years old and I was amazed...little did I know how much pleasure I would get from all the movies and spin offs that were to come over the next 5 decades.
I saw each and every episode of that show and also every different version first run, now with Netflix I turned my wife on to them and she also loves watching them all for the first time in her life.
Star Wars is fine, loved all the Stargate series and everything else but I am a Trekkie at heart, no other sci fy show or series had characters that became so close to me...like family.
Not every episode of every show was great and there were some bad ones but some pretty great ones were in there too.
In the grand scope of things there are so many historical milestones that were more important but the impact this show had on me on this date so long ago was, has been and will always be tremendous to this dyed in the wool sci-fi freak.
